Abstract

We present our recent results on the scattering length of 4He\ensuremath-4He2 collisions. These investigations are based on the hard-core version of the Faddeev differential equations. As compared to our previous calculations of the same quantity, a much more refined grid is employed, providing an improvement of about 10%. Our results are compared with other ab initio and model calculations.
